Cajun Pea & Potato Salad & Spring Onion Dressing

Serves: 4
Preparation: 15 minutes
Cooking Time: 20 minutes



Ingredients

  • 600g Charlotte potatoes
  • 300g frozen peas
  • 3 boiled eggs shelled and cut into quarters
  • For the Dressing:
  • 2 tsp Cajun spice mix
  • ½ tsp paprika
  • A little olive oil
  • 2tbsp mayonnaise
  • 4 spring onions, finely chopped
  • 1 tsp wholegrain mustard
  • 1 tsp Dijon mustard
  • 1 tsp white wine vinegar
  • Chopped parsley or Chives to garnish

Method

  1. Cook the potatoes until just tender, about 18 mins.
  2. Drain and cut into bite sized pieces.
  3. Cook the peas in boiling water for two mins and mix with the potato, season to taste.
  4. Cook the Cajun spice and paprika in a little olive oil in a small saucepan for about 1 minute on a low heat.
  5. Cool and add to the mayonnaise along with the spring onions, whole grain mustard, Dijon mustard and white wine vinegar.
  6. Toss through the warm potatoes and peas, add the eggs, saving three quarters to garnish along with some chopped parsley or chives.
